19 minutes ago, BlazerBuddy said:

I have the lian li Lancool 2 and have a 5th fan that I don't know where to put, my current fan orientation is 2 front 1 top 1 back. Should I change it to 2 front 2 top and 1 back or 3 front 1 top 1 back??

What size are your fans, and specifically the 5th fan? You can only do three up front if they're 120mm. If they're 140mm, you only get two. I would avoid the top front, as you're just working against yourself with that. A front top exhaust is going to just immediately eject the fresh intake from the front, and a front top intake is going to create vortexes that will also prevent the fresh intake from reaching your components.

 

If you can, I'd use the extra fan to do 3 front intake. Otherwise, just leave it out. Just because you have 5 fans doesn't mean you must or even should use all 5 fans. More fans doesn't equal more better.
